About The Position

Index Exchange is a global advertising supply-side platform enabling media owners to maximize the value of their content on any screen. As a trusted partner and ally, we connect leading experience makers with the world’s largest brands to ensure a quality experience for consumers. We’re a proud industry pioneer with over 20 years of experience accelerating the ad technology evolution. With our radically transparent business practices and dedication to total market efficiency, we’re committed to upholding the integrity of the programmatic ecosystem at large. The Opportunity: Index Exchange is looking for a Buyer Development, Senior Director to help grow and deepen our commercial partnerships across the US independent agency ecosystem and within the political vertical. This includes independent agencies, agency groups, specialist consultancies, and emerging buyer models shaping the future of programmatic investment. Index is financially strong, independent, and in growth mode, with modern technology and no legacy platform drag. We are moving fast in the areas buyers care about most, including streaming, sell-side decisioning, and Marketplace innovation, while remaining grounded in transparency, neutrality, and partnership. In this role, you will own relationships across independent agencies and political demand partners setting strategy and driving consistent execution. You will drive revenue growth through product adoption and build long-term relationships and partnership value, while acting as the senior buyer voice within Index. This role sits at the intersection of commercial leadership, buyer strategy, and marketplace innovation. This is your opportunity to help us define the next phase of buyer strategy at Index Exchange.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in digital media with deep knowledge of the programmatic advertising ecosystem (SSP, DSP, exchange, PMP, agency trading desk, ad server, etc.)
  • Solid understanding of the independent agency landscape, including operating models and buying structures
  • Experience working with political demand partners
  • Your network boasts deep relationships and demonstrates your comfort navigating a range of commercial models through strong agency and brand connections; an existing network across independent agencies is ideal
  • Proven success in buyer-facing sales roles within ad tech or programmatic environments
  • Confidence delivering technical explanations, education, and strategic recommendations to partners

Responsibilities

  • Own and lead relationships with independent agencies and political demand partners within the US market
  • Design and execute an impactful sales strategy to drive demand across independent agencies, establishing and nurturing executive-level relationships
  • Drive revenue growth and increased adoption of Index’s buyer-facing products across agencies and buying teams
  • Act as a trusted advisor on SPO, marketplace quality, curation, data activation, and evolving buying models
  • Increase executive alignment through strategic planning sessions, QBRs, and senior stakeholder engagement
  • Represent the buyer perspective internally, influencing Product roadmap and go-to-market decisions
  • Identify new commercial opportunities within independent agencies
  • Partner closely with Buyer Account Management teams to ensure consistent execution and impact across accounts
  • Maintain an accurate and robust pipeline, providing regular sales activity and revenue forecasts, and leveraging our CRM for maximum transparency and tracking
  • Monitor key industry trends, competitive insights and market conditions to inform strategic direction and identify new business opportunities
  • Represent Index at industry events and senior partner forums
